The cheapest way to get from Exeter to Newcastle-under-Lyme is to bus which costs £16 - £45 and takes 5h 50m.
The fastest way to get from Exeter to Newcastle-under-Lyme is to drive which takes 3h 12m and costs £45 - £75.
No, there is no direct bus from Exeter to Newcastle-under-Lyme station. However, there are services departing from Bampfylde Street and arriving at Bus Station via Bus Station and Newhall St.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 50m.
No, there is no direct train from Exeter to Newcastle-under-Lyme. However, there are services departing from Exeter St Davids and arriving at Stoke-on-Trent via Birmingham New Street.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 37m.
The distance between Exeter and Newcastle-under-Lyme is 210 miles. The road distance is 197.3 miles.
The best way to get from Exeter to Newcastle-under-Lyme without a car is to train which takes 3h 37m and costs £55 - £180.
It takes approximately 3h 37m to get from Exeter to Newcastle-under-Lyme, including transfers.
Exeter to Newcastle-under-Lyme b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Bampfylde Street station.
Exeter to Newcastle-under-Lyme train services, operated by Cross Country, depart from Exeter St Davids station.
The best way to get from Exeter to Newcastle-under-Lyme is to train which takes 3h 37m and costs £55 - £180.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£16 - £45 and takes 5h 50m.
